From Idea to Action: Stories from Alabama Innovators is a podcast that highlights the people who are driving Alabama forward. We aim to showcase and connect the deep network of innovators, entrepreneurs, policy leaders, and advocates working to make Alabama an even better place. From Idea to Action: Stories from Alabama Innovators is powered by the HudsonAlpha Institute for Biotechnology, a nonprofit organization with a mission to improve the human condition.

    • Episode 19: Bill Poole and Cynthia Crutchfield
      Nov 7 2023

      This episode features Bill Poole, Finance Director for the State of Alabama, and Cynthia Crutchfield, CEO of Innovate Alabama. These two Alabama leaders discuss how the State and Innovate Alabama support entrepreneurs, businesses, and commercialization. They share about the history of the Innovation Commission that kicked off new resources for Alabama citizens, what the future looks like for Alabama businesses, and the opportunities for support that lay ahead.

    • Episode 18: Todd Greer with Innovation Portal in Mobile, AL
      Oct 24 2023

      In this episode, we sit down with Todd Greer, Executive Director of Innovation Portal, a nonprofit incubator and innovation hub accelerating startup growth in the Gulf Coast Region. We discuss how to support small businesses and what it takes to nurture economic growth and draw similarities between Mobile and the other major cities across Alabama.

    • Episode 17: Sean Powers with The University of South Alabama
      Oct 10 2023

      Description:
      In this episode, we sit down to talk with Sean Powers, PhD, Angelia and Steven Stokes Endowed Professor in Environmental Resiliency and Director, Stokes School of Marine Sciences, University of South Alabama. Over the course of this episode, we talk about his journey to Alabama and how Gulf Coast research and global fishery research inform conservation decisions and help our water systems thrive.
